Planning a bathroom or kitchen refit
Bathroom and kitchen refits involve more plumbing decisions than most property owners anticipate at the outset. The location of water supply entries, the routing of waste pipes, the condition of existing connections, and the surface finishes all shape what is achievable without additional structural or building work.
Discussing these considerations at the enquiry stage means the scope of plumbing work can be clearly defined — avoiding surprises mid-renovation and ensuring the plumbing elements align with the wider project plan.

Refit planning considerations
- Existing fixture locations and proposed changes
- Water supply entry points and routes
- Hot water source and pressure
- Waste routes and drainage gradients
- Access beneath floors and behind walls
- Surface finishes and tile considerations
- Renovation timeline and trade coordination
- Agreed plumbing scope and phasing
